    reinstalled wordfence, at the end of the first and successful scan, despite a ‘no problems’ outcome, at the end of detailed scan it had error text (below)

    it is showing it on every wordfence page and is big n red at the top of the ‘view activity log’ page, but that doesn’t fit in with the no problems found outcome.

    any help on what it is, whether serious and what to do, much appreciated.

    wp 4.8.1 newspaper 8.1 theme php 7.1

    [Aug 21 22:20:49:1503346849.806444:1:error] <br /> <b>Notice</b>: Undefined index: adrotate-pro/adrotate-pro.php in <b>/home/gibbsyns3/public_html/wp-content/plugins/adrotate-pro/library/update-api.php</b> on line <b>73</b><br /> <br /> <b>Notice</b>: unserialize(): Error at offset 0 of 2136 bytes in <b>/home/gibbsyns3/public_html/wp-content/plugins/js_composer/include/classes/updaters/class-vc-updating-manager.php</b> on line <b>149</b><br /> <br /> <b>Warning</b>: Creating default object from empty value in <b>/home/gibbsyns3/public_html/wp-content/plugins/js_composer/include/classes/updaters/class-vc-updating-manager.php</b> on line <b>118</b><br /> <br /> <b>Notice</b>: Undefined property: stdClass::$sections in <b>/home/gibbsyns3/public_html/wp-content/plugins/js_composer/include/classes/updaters/class-vc-updating-manager.php</b> on line <b>119</b><br /> 0

    You’re getting a “no problems” result because the Wordfence scan didn’t find any issue during all the checks it was able to perform.

    But it appears that the scan encountered problems when trying to check if the adrotate and js_composer plugins needed an update.

    It seems both plugins’ update functions are not properly working. Therefore I suggest you get in touch with each plugin authors so they can identify the cause of the error.
